MP Namal Rajapaksa taking to his official Twitter handle has congratulated Ranil Wickremesinghe on his appointment as Prime Minister.
In his tweet, MP Rajapaksa said he hopes that PM Wickremesinghe would work towards ensuring the sovereignty of this country and address the issues of the people more rather than give prominence to Western interests.
Politics aside I would like to congratulate @RW_UNP being appointed as the Prime Minister of Sri Lanka. I hope at least now he will work towards ensuring the sovereignty of this country and more so address issues of our people more than Western interests.
— Namal Rajapaksa (@RajapaksaNamal) December 16, 2018
